検索して一覧作成 (OR 演算)No.11141
Iranoan さん 04/10/28 18:39
 
 秀まるおさん今日は、Iranoan です。
 検索して一覧作成における OR 演算について、質問とバグ報告です。

●質問
 「条件 1」以外は、「Message-Id 検索」「メールアドレス検索」が指定で
きませんが、これは仕様でしょうか? OR の時は、指定できた方が便利だと思
います。
 実際の検索ではあまり使いませんが、「メール一覧」の「表示範囲」の指定
では、使えると便利です。(両者の方が、普通の検索より高速なので)

●バグ報告
 検索の履歴が、
("a@hoge.hoge", word, target=person)or("b@hoge.hoge", target="Reply-To:")
となるような指定、つまり「条件 1」に「メールアドレス検索」を指定し、
「条件 2」に「特定のヘッダ内...」を指定すると、「条件 2」にヒットすべ
きメールがヒットしません。

 こちらの環境は、Windows98+IE6.0+鶴亀 Ver.3.71 です。

[ ]
RE:11141 検索して一覧作成 (OR 演算)No.11142
秀まるお さん 04/10/28 22:26
 
 メールアドレス検索およびMessage-Id検索は、それ用の特別な処理があるだけ
でして、他の検索条件とのAND/ORは無理だと思います。なので、そういう指定が
出来てしまうとしたら、それがバグってことになります。

 苦労すれば、そういう複数条件指定も可能かもしれませんけど…。

 検索ダイアログボックス上で、そういう複数条件指定できないような制限を付
けたいと思います。

 とりあえず、そういう条件指定は出来ないってことで使って欲しいです。

[ ]
RE:11142 検索して一覧作成 (OR 演算)No.11143
Iranoan さん 04/10/29 00:15
 
 秀まるおさん今日は、Iranoan です。
>  メールアドレス検索およびMessage-Id検索は、それ用の特別な処理があるだけ
> でして、他の検索条件とのAND/ORは無理だと思います。
<snip>
>  検索ダイアログボックス上で、そういう複数条件指定できないような制限を付
> けたいと思います。
 解りました。

[ ]
RE:11143 検索して一覧作成 (OR 演算)No.11181
秀まるお さん 04/11/09 15:04
 
 今さらソースコードを見直してる所ですが、やっぱり、「メールアドレス検
索」および「Message-Id検索」と他の検索条件をOR指定した場合にうまく検索し
ないのは、バグのようです。

 ただし、OR指定した場合は、通常のメールアドレス検索/Message-Id検索の高
速性はまったく発揮しないことになります。

 ということで修正させていただきます。

[ ]
RE:11181 検索して一覧作成 (OR 演算)No.11182
Iranoan さん 04/11/09 18:11
 
 秀まるおさん今日は、Iranoan です。
>  ただし、OR指定した場合は、通常のメールアドレス検索/Message-Id検索の高
> 速性はまったく発揮しないことになります。
>
>  ということで修正させていただきます。
 高速性が無くなるのは致し方ないですが、宜しくお願いします。

[ ]